Where to Meet New People in Norwalk, CT

1. Norwalk Harbor and Seaport District: This historic waterfront district is a popular spot for socializing, with its picturesque views, charming shops and restaurants, and frequent events and festivals.

2. Calf Pasture Beach: This popular beach is a hub for socializing, especially during the summer months. Visitors can swim, sunbathe, play beach sports, and enjoy food and drinks at the beachside restaurants and bars.

3. Norwalk Farmers Market: This weekly market is not just a place to shop for fresh produce, but also a gathering place for locals to catch up with friends and neighbors. The market also often features live music and food trucks, making it a fun and social event.

4. The SoNo Collection: This upscale shopping mall is not just a place to shop, but also a popular social spot for locals and tourists alike. With its many restaurants, bars, and entertainment options, it's a great place to meet up with friends or make new ones.

5. O'Neill's Irish Pub: This lively pub is a favorite spot for socializing in Norwalk, with its friendly atmosphere, live music, and traditional Irish food and drinks. It's a great place to meet up with friends for a pint or to make new friends over a game of darts or pool.

FAQ about Norwalk, CT

1. What is Norwalk known for?
Norwalk is known for its maritime heritage and being home to attractions such as the Maritime Aquarium and Sheffield Island Lighthouse.

2. What are some popular outdoor activities in Norwalk?
Some popular outdoor activities in Norwalk include kayaking and paddleboarding on the Norwalk River, hiking at Cranbury Park, and visiting Calf Pasture Beach.

3. What is the population of Norwalk?
According to the latest census data, the population of Norwalk is approximately 88,000 people.

4. Is Norwalk a safe city to live in?
Yes, Norwalk is considered a relatively safe city with a lower crime rate compared to other cities in Connecticut.

5. Are there any notable annual events in Norwalk?
Yes, Norwalk hosts several annual events, including the Norwalk Oyster Festival, the SoNo Arts Festival, and the Norwalk Boat Show.
